Leaky wave microstrip antenna with a prescribable pattern
First Claim
1. A leaky wave microstrip antenna comprising:
- a grounded element;
a dielectric member coupled to the grounded element; and
a conducting strip coupled to the dielectric member, the conducting strip including;
a first non-radiating conducting strip;
a second non-radiating conducting strip; and
a plurality of radiating cells, each of the plurality of cells having a generally uniform width and separated by a generally uniform inter-cell spacing, each cell including;
a first end, the first end coupled to said first non-radiating conducting strip; and
a second end, the second end coupled to said second non-radiating conducting strip.

Abstract
A system and method for prescribing an amplitude distribution to a leaky-wave microstrip antenna having an array of radiating cells. The leaky-wave microstrip antenna includes a grounded element, a dielectric member coupled to the grounded element and a top conducting strip coupled to the dielectric member, the conducting strip including a first and second non-radiating conducting strip and a plurality of radiating cells. This distribution requires that the microstrip antenna possess a variable leakage-constant profile along its length, and is chosen so as to yield an H-plane power-gain pattern having low sidelobes. The leakage-constant profile is achieved by configuring the width and inter-cell spacing of the antenna radiating cells and keeping the phase constant fixed. The length or loading of the radiating cells may also be manipulated to achieve the desired leakage constant profile. This results in the desired distribution along the antenna'"'"'s aperture and yields a power-gain pattern with low sidelobes. The antenna is excited by two equal-amplitude and 180° out-of-phase signals. These signals are applied to the feed end of the microstrip at two feeding ports. The microstrip antenna length is chosen such that more than 97% of the input power is radiated by the traveling electromagnetic, wave, while the remaining power is absorbed by the resistively terminated antenna end.
